When Sanjay Dutt Said "Marriage Is A Heart Attack" And Why He Falls In Love With Every Woman He Dates

Sanjay Dutt has had a few notable relationships spanning his career in the movies. While the linkups were often making a buzz, he has also had three marriages.
Interestingly, Sanjay Dutt shared his take on marriage and relationships back in Koffee with Karan Season 1 (2005), when he had graced the Koffee couch with Sushmita Sen.
What's Happening
Sanjay Dutt had some notable insights to share on marriage and relationships back when he was a guest on Koffee with Karan Season 1 with Sushmita Sen.
When asked about relationships, he had said, "I love to be loved. I love homebody to hold me, cuddle me, treat me like a son, and I just live being loved... I'm more romantic today."
"Marriage is a commitment that you have to accept. There were Nargis and Sunil Dutt. Women had to sacrifice a lot at that time. And today I've not seen a happy man, I don't know why," added the Munnabhai actor.
As the host, Karan Johar further probed about the institution of marriage, which seemed to be dwindling, Sanjay Dutt answered, "I think both people have to be committed."
On being asked if it is difficult to be faithful to one's spouse, the actor said, "It's not difficult to be faithful, but to adjust is very difficult."
His co-guest Sushmita Sen then made a hilarious comment on how he would know whom to marry if he was going to be in love with every woman he'd been in a relationship with, Sanjay Dutt said, "I've got a big heart, Sush. I love these heart attacks (marriage)."
Sanjay Dutt Marriages
Sanjay Dutt has been married thrice. His first marriage was to actress Richa Sharma in 1987, who passed away in 1996 due to brain cancer. In 1998, he married model Rhea Pillai, but they got divorced in 2008.
In the same year, he married Maanayata Dutt. They have twins named Shahraan and Iqra, who were born on October 21, 2010, and both of them will turn 15 this year.

Bilaspur bizman held for obstructing traffic while celebrating actor Sanjay Dutt's birthday

Raipur: A 52-year-old businessman was arrested on Monday for obstructing traffic while publicly celebrating Bollywood actor Sanjay Dutt's birthday in the heart of Bilaspur city. The celebration caused inconvenience to commuters and emergency vehicles, including an ambulance. The accused, identified as Gurudev Awasthi, alias Chittu Awasthi, a self-proclaimed die-hard fan of the actor, was booked under Section 285 of the Bharatiya Nyaya Sanhita (BNS), Civil Lines SHO S R Sahu said. The offence is bailable. The incident occurred between 8 pm and 10 pm, during which multiple vehicles, including an ambulance, were caught in a traffic jam triggered by the celebration, police said. Awasthi organised a public event to mark the actor's birthday, inviting local residents and drawing a large crowd. Loud music was played, and people gathered to dance. A video of Awasthi dancing on stage at the event has since gone viral. According to police, Awasthi celebrated Sanjay Dutt's birthday for nearly three decades. He reportedly spends about 25% of his annual income on the celebrations. During the actor's imprisonment, Awasthi is said to have performed special prayers and rituals for his release. Following Dutt's release, he reportedly distributed one quintal of laddoos to inmates at the Bilaspur Central Jail. Locals claimed that the actor also joined the celebrations live via video call. To Shah Rukh Khan On Winning First-Ever National Award, Shout Out From Wife Gauri And Daughter Suhana: "Ready To Brag About This"

New Delhi: The winners of the 71st National Film Awards were announced on Friday. Recently, Gauri Khan expressed pride and joy as three of her "closest" people, Shah Rukh Khan, Rani Mukerji, and Karan Johar, were honoured at the National Film Awards. What's Happening Shah Rukh Khan received the Best Actor award for his performance in Jawan, while Rani Mukerji won Best Actress for her role in Mrs Chatterjee vs Norway. Karan Johar's Rocky Aur Rani Kii Prem Kahaani, starring Alia Bhatt and Ranveer Singh, bagged the award for Best Popular Film Providing Wholesome Entertainment. Sharing her happiness on Instagram, Gauri wrote, "Three of my absolute favourites just WON big... and so did our hearts... When talent meets goodness, magic happens - So proud, and so ready to brag about them forever!" She also posted a selfie with Shah Rukh and Rani, followed by another picture featuring Karan and Rani. View this post on Instagram A post shared by Gauri Khan (@gaurikhan) Background Suhana Khan also penned a heartfelt message for Shah Rukh Khan, along with a throwback photo. She wrote, "From bedtime stories to stories that leave a mark, No one tells them like you. Congratulations, love you the most @iamsrk." Reacting to his win, Shah Rukh Khan posted a video message on social media, saying, "I'm overwhelmed with gratitude, pride and humility. To be honored with the National Award is a moment that I will cherish for a lifetime. Thank you so much to the jury, the chairman and to the INB ministry and to everyone who thought I was worthy of this honor. I want to thank all my directors and writers, especially for the year 2023. So thank you Raju sir, thank you Saeed and especially thanks to Atlee sir and his team for giving me the opportunity in Jawaan and trusting me to deliver and be worthy of this award." Jacqueline on pole dancing: Extremely difficult but worth it

Bollywood actress Jacqueline Fernandez showcased her dancing prowess on the pole and said that it's extremely difficult but so worth it. Jacqueline took to Instagram, where she shared that pole dancing is all about strength and training. The video had Habits (Stay High) by Swedish singer Tove Lo playing in the background. 'Pure strength and training. Extremely difficult but so worth it once you take off! Back after ages,' she wrote as the caption. The actress' latest release is 'Housefull 5', which also stars Akshay Kumar, Abhishek Bachchan, Riteish Deshmukh, and Sonam Bajwa are just a few of the stars who are set to light up the screen. Also joining the cast are Nargis Fakhri, Sanjay Dutt, Jackie Shroff, Nana Patekar, Chitrangada Singh, Fardeen Khan, Chunky Pandey, Johnny Lever, Shreyas Talpade, Dino Morea, Ranjeet, Soundarya Sharma, Nikitin Dheer, and Akashdeep Sabir. Produced by Sajid Nadiadwala under the banner Nadiadwala Grandson Entertainment, 'Housefull 5' released on June 6. The film follows multiple imposters who claim to be the son of a recently deceased billionaire as they compete for his fortune while aboard a luxury cruise ship. The first installment of the 'Housefull' franchise released in 2010 and was loosely based on the 1998 Tamil film Kaathala Kaathala. The second installment hit the big screens in 2012. Meanwhile, Housefull 3 and Housefull 4 released in 2016 and 2019 respectively. She will next be seen in 'Welcome To The Jungle'. Directed by Ahmed Khan, the film boasts a massive budget.
